Decrease in avocado harvest With about 30% of global production, Mexico is the largest avocado producer. As a result of profitability and increasing international demand, the area planted is still increasing by about three percent annually. Michoacán is the state where most of Mexico's avocado production takes place. It is also the only state with phytosanitary agreements to be able to export to the United States. Jalisco is the second most important avocado producing state. The harvest forecast for the 2021/2022 season, which runs from July to June, is 2.33 million tons of avocado. That is a decrease of 8% compared to last season. Last season was a record season and avocado trees in the state of Michoacán in particular will have to recover from this. The harvest in other states is expected to decrease as a result of high temperatures and insufficient rainfall.
